From 0c70c3e4dd2ad54d88e955933fee2dc2494dce0e Mon Sep 17 00:00:00 2001 From: Tom Augspurger Date: Wed, 26 Jun 2019 14:22:13 -0500 Subject: [PATCH 1/2] COMPAT: 32-bit nargsort https://github.com/MacPython/pandas-wheels/pull/51 --- pandas/tests/extension/base/methods.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/pandas/tests/extension/base/methods.py b/pandas/tests/extension/base/methods.py index 94069994079e3..dac84abf109c7 100644 --- a/pandas/tests/extension/base/methods.py +++ b/pandas/tests/extension/base/methods.py @@ -53,8 +53,8 @@ def test_argsort_missing(self, data_missing_for_sorting): self.assert_series_equal(result, expected) @pytest.mark.parametrize('na_position, expected', [ - ('last', np.array([2, 0, 1], dtype='int64')), - ('first', np.array([1, 2, 0], dtype='int64')) + ('last', np.array([2, 0, 1], dtype='int')), + ('first', np.array([1, 2, 0], dtype='int')) ]) def test_nargsort(self, data_missing_for_sorting, na_position, expected): # GH 25439 From 631be47c9f741ef0ae91a98b3cb7fe6603437f8f Mon Sep 17 00:00:00 2001 From: Tom Augspurger Date: Thu, 27 Jun 2019 08:27:46 -0500 Subject: [PATCH 2/2] try intp? --- pandas/tests/extension/base/methods.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/pandas/tests/extension/base/methods.py b/pandas/tests/extension/base/methods.py index dac84abf109c7..d9e61e6a227e6 100644 --- a/pandas/tests/extension/base/methods.py +++ b/pandas/tests/extension/base/methods.py @@ -53,8 +53,8 @@ def test_argsort_missing(self, data_missing_for_sorting): self.assert_series_equal(result, expected) @pytest.mark.parametrize('na_position, expected', [ - ('last', np.array([2, 0, 1], dtype='int')), - ('first', np.array([1, 2, 0], dtype='int')) + ('last', np.array([2, 0, 1], dtype=np.dtype('intp'))), + ('first', np.array([1, 2, 0], dtype=np.dtype('intp'))) ]) def test_nargsort(self, data_missing_for_sorting, na_position, expected): # GH 25439